Master Production Schedule definition

Master Production Schedule means a two monthly schedule a sample of which is attached hereto as Part 2 of the Schedule given by Adobe to Xxxxx which may include inter alia: an estimate of the materials projected by Adobe to be needed by Xxxxx for the manufacture of one or more Adobe Product Packages; a forecast of Finished Goods required by Adobe to be provided by Xxxxx; and details of any goods given to Xxxxx by Adobe to be worked upon by Xxxxx in accordance with Adobe's instructions.
